Removal
1. Disconnect battery ground cable.2. Drain engine cooling system and remove the fan motor.
3. Remove air cleaner outlet tube.
4. Relieve fuel system pressure and disconnect fuel lines.
5. Remove windshield wiper governor.
6. Release drive belt tensioner and remove drive belt
7. Raise vehicle on a hoist.
Gasoline Engine:
8. Disconnect fuel charging wiring from crankshaft position sensor (CKP sensor) and A/C clutch.
9. Remove oil bypass filter.
10. Disconnect fuel charging wiring from oil pressure sensor, oil filter adapter bracket and power steering pump and move fuel charging wiring out of the way.
11. Disconnect EGR valve to exhaust manifold tube from RH exhaust manifold.
12. Disconnect EGR back pressure transducer hoses from EGR valve to exhaust manifold tube.
13. Disconnect fuel charging wiring from heated oxygen sensors (HO2S).
14. Lower vehicle.
15. Disconnect all ignition wires from all ignition coils.
16. Disconnect fuel charging wiring from the eight ignition coils and eight fuel injectors and camshaft position sensor (CAP sensor).
17. Disconnect fuel charging wiring from generator (GEN).
18. Disconnect generator wiring harness from power distribution box at front fender apron and from generator.
19. Remove two bolts retaining generator mounting bracket to intake manifold.
20. Remove two bolts retaining generator (GEN) to cylinder block and remove generator.
21. Remove positive crankcase ventilation valve (PCV valve) from valve cover.
22. Disconnect vacuum hose from throttle body adapter vacuum port.
23. Disconnect evaporative emission hose from throttle body adapter port.
24. Remove heater water hoses.
25. Disconnect engine control sensor extension wire from 42-pin connector and eight-pin transmission connector located at power brake booster.
26. Disconnect engine control sensor extension wire from EVR sensor, idle air control valve (IAC valve), EGR transducer, throttle position sensor (TP sensor), ignition coils and fuel injectors.
27. Remove fuel charging wiring retainers from valve cover stud bolts.
28. Remove fuel charging wiring and transmission wiring from bracket on rear of LH cylinder head.
29. Disconnect accelerator cable and speed control actuator cable using a screwdriver or similar tool.
Accelerator Cable:
30. Remove two bolts and intake manifold shield.
31. Disconnect main emission vacuum control connector from fuel injection supply manifold and evaporative emission valve.
32. Disconnect EGR valve to exhaust manifold tube from EGR valve (EGR valve) and remove EGR valve to exhaust manifold tube.
33. Remove accelerator cable bracket stud bolt.
34. Remove five retaining bolts from throttle body adapter to intake manifold.
35. Remove two bolts retaining water hose connection to intake manifold. Position water hose connection and upper radiator hose out of way.
36. Remove nine bolts retaining intake manifold to the cylinder heads and remove intake manifold.
NOTE: The fuel charging wiring, fuel injection supply manifold and fuel injector nozzle tip can remain attached to the intake manifold.
37. Remove intake manifold gaskets.
